Garrison Brothers sets an August release for Laguna Madre

The eight-year Texas bourbon returns with an exact distillery release date in Hye.

Official source · Announcement only · Last checked 2026-07-21

Signal summary

Garrison Brothers lists its 2026 Laguna Madre release party at the Hye distillery for August 8. The 101-proof bourbon spends four years in American oak and four more in French Limousin oak.

The release

Laguna Madre combines extended Texas aging with maturation in American oak and French Limousin oak for one of Garrison Brothers' most limited annual releases.

Exact event signal

August 8 is the official Hye distillery release-party date. It does not establish a synchronized arrival date for outside retail markets.
